Bendiocarb is a carbamate insecticide that can be harmful to humans if ingested, inhaled, or absorbed through the skin. It may cause symptoms such as n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, and respiratory issues due to its mechanism of inhibiting the enzyme acetylcholinesterase. Proper handling and protective measures are essential when using products containing bendiocarb to minimize exposure and potential health risks. Always follow safety guidelines and regulations when dealing with pesticides.
